...People with high folate and low B12 status were found to be at a
disadvantage when compared to those with normal folate and low B12
status; the former group was more likely to exhibit both anemia and
cognitive impairment, according to Jacques. A single cognitive
function test was used to assess aptitudes such as response speed,
sustained attention, visual-spatial skills, associative learning and
memory....
